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 8 Weeks
Mounting Type Through Hole
Package / Case 24-DIP Module, 14 Leads
Surface MountNO
Operating Temperature-40°C~100°C With Derating
Series EC4A-E (6W)
Size / Dimension 1.25Lx0.80W x 0.40 H 31.8mmx20.3mmx10.2mm
Feature SCP, UVLO
Part StatusActive
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 14
ECCN Code EAR99
Type Isolated Module
Applications ITE (Commercial)
Power (Watts) 6W
Subcategory Other Analog ICs
Technology HYBRID
Terminal Position DUAL
Number of Functions 1
Terminal Pitch2.54mm
Number of Outputs 1
Qualification StatusNot Qualified
Efficiency 85%
Voltage - Isolation 500V
Voltage - Input (Max) 18V
Output Voltage 15V
Voltage - Output 1 15V
Voltage - Input (Min) 9V
Input Voltage-Nom 12V
Trim/Adjustable Output NO
Current - Output (Max) 400mA
Total Power Output-Max 6W
Width 20.3mm
RoHS StatusROHS3 Compliant
